Card 3

Question: Are most rare craniofacial clefts familial or sporadic?

Answer: Most rare craniofacial clefts occur sporadically, though some familial cases exist.

Card 4

Question: Which syndromes mentioned show a hereditary role in rare craniofacial clefts?

Answer: Treacher–Collins syndrome and some familial cases of Goldenhar syndrome.

Card 5

Question: What gene defect causes Treacher–Collins syndrome and what is notable about its penetrance?

Answer: A dominant defect in the TCOF-1 gene causes Treacher–Collins syndrome; penetrance is somewhat variable but the malformation is very consistent.

Card 6

Question: What embryologic process was disrupted in the TCOF-1 knock-out animal model, and what facial abnormality resulted?

Answer: Massive regional cell death affected neural crest (crest cell mesenchymal) migration, resulting in zygomatic abnormalities.

Card 8

Question: What four major environmental categories have been shown to cause facial clefts in animal and human studies?

Answer: (1) Radiation, (2) infection, (3) maternal metabolic imbalances, and (4) drugs and chemicals.

Card 9

Question: Which class of medications is noted as being investigated for causing facial malformations?

Answer: Medications containing retinoic acid are being investigated as potential causes of facial malformations.
